The “Please wait…” usually means that the device went to sleep during the configuration process. Try going to the device’s settings and set Automatically Configure to Yes. They should wake it up and run it through the process. Also note, that when Gen 5/Z-Wave Plus devices are using Network Wide Inclusion that during pairing there is more data being exchanged than normal and distance can slow that down, try moving the device closer for the pairing process, it can help.
